Abstract
Irreducible ankle fracture-dislocations are very rare entities. The present case report
demonstrates an unusual finding of tibialis posterior and flexor digitorum longus
tendons interposed in the tibiofibular joint impairing successful closed reduction
of ankle fracture-dislocation. A 45-year-old patient presented with a bimalleolar
pronation-external rotation ankle fracture-dislocation after a motorcycle accident.
Attempts to perform closed reduction before surgery were unsuccessful. Subsequent
urgent open reduction and internal fixation surgical management revealed interposition
of the tibialis posterior and flexor digitorum longus tendons in the tibiofibular
joint. In irreducible fracture-dislocation of the ankle with severe lateral displacement
of the talus, one should be aware of the possibility of soft tissue interposition
of the tibialis posterior and flexor digitorum longus tendons in the tibiofibular
joint.
